Output 6f5e24d5255b667ffd81f2ef2e43da257aff2e3d47b43520f68febbcc6e82955:1

value
26904771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b855cc627fe0a98c53eb67a5944997242ec8cd2 OP_EQUAL
address
3BVXzFYLhisDiCUXcpj6aLRCPmnZUr1Ynv
transaction
6f5e24d5255b667ffd81f2ef2e43da257aff2e3d47b43520f68febbcc6e82955
spent
true